The fastest way is of course by plain.
On Crete there are 2 airports, Iraklio and Chania.

During the season (april - early november) you can fly almost from everywhere directly.
In wintertime you have to take scheduled flights via Athens/Thessaloniki.


Iraklio is the nearest airport to Messara. You have to go about 1-2  hours
by car to any place in the Messara, from Chania about 3 hours.
Taxis from the airport Iraklio are about 55 Euros, from Chania accordingly more.
You can go also by car via Yugoslavia/the „Autoput“. They are saying it is more safe
to drive there now and there are better roads than the last years.
Of course the slowest way is by ship. But it might be quite nice and lot of fun or
a little adventure, that depends among other things on the weather.

From Italy (Tirest, Venice, Ancona, Bari, Brindisi,...) you ship with your car or bike
or campingbus or whatever to the greek main. Then by car or bus to Athens/Pireas
and again by boat to Iraklio or Chania.
There different ship lines like: Minoan, Anek, Superfast Ferries, ...
There are quite good bus connections from both airports. Thats of course
not so expensive, it may take more time and it´s not available 24 hours a day.


The best thing is to order a hiredcar, there is airport service at no charge available.
